As Flagship Program and Pathways Manager, Tamara works with Clubhouse youth to explore professional jobs and academic opportunities, build work readiness skills, plan for the future, and realize their potential. Tamara also manages the Clubhouse program for girls and young women. Previously she served with the Commonwealth Corps program at Peer Health Exchange, and was selected as a Raheem Baraka Community Impact Fellow at American Heart Association where she worked with local organizers to address food & nutrition insecurity and other health equity issues in priority neighborhoods of Boston. Tamara is a graduate of Lasell University where she majored in Health Sciences, participated in the Leadership Scholars program, and served on the Executive Boards of multiple diversity-focused student-led organizations on campus.
